You may also be interested in...

Thea Tea Shop

110-112 Gawler Pl, Adelaide SA 500

 

Teamate

17-21 George St, Blackburn VIC 313

 

Delicious Drop

272 Yarra St, Warrandyte VIC 311

 

Calmer Sutra Tea

622 Hawthorn Rd, Brighton East VIC 318

 

Tease Tea Pty Ltd

Fcty9/ 5-7 Olive Gr, Keysborough VIC 317

 

Elmstock & Dalhurst Teas

Shop 19, 242 Darling St, Balmain NSW 204

 

Which Brew? Herbal Teas

19 Kanimbla Ave, Leopold VIC 322

 

To add a review, login, sign up or Login with Facebook Write a Review

Rate this Business

All Reviews

 
FreeDirectory